I'll be playing this format next week. I've never heard of it so tried to google it but I found only conflicting definitions.

It looks like each player drives but then it's not clear if you only play the best ball (alternate shots) or you swap balls. The former makes more sense to me.

Also, is there a limit to the number of better drives that one can have? I'm playing with a lady so my ball is likely to be the best one off the tee quite often. Excluding the oob on the right at the 13th...

One american golf forum says that a player can't have more than 12 better balls.
 
Not sure about the first bit, but you may be surprised to find that you don't want to take your drive too often. Reason being, if the lady is anything like my mixed pairs partner, then you'll be taking hers. Reason being she hits it straight and long enough to give us (i.e. me) a shot into every par 4 and most par 5's (albeit 3 wood or hybrid), so we often take hers.

See what kind of driver she is, and then make your decision based on that, not based on the fact she's a woman!
 
Or second shot greensome. you both drive you hit her drive she hits yours you then make your mind up which ball to finish the hole with.
